Output c9596e85c6adcc0604c57923f7ec5ef4c2ff2b0574ba614619e4d5ed1d546738:53

value
3496014
script pubkey
OP_0 OP_PUSHBYTES_20 16f6668b326d5a775f15ebccacb44a055e312ebe
address
bc1qzmmxdzejd4d8whc4a0x2edz2q40rzt47xhq02e
transaction
c9596e85c6adcc0604c57923f7ec5ef4c2ff2b0574ba614619e4d5ed1d546738